Output e0f2b58a1d7c2f4bcc14b8145848356b052003396b70ca256935bbe30358c876:70

value
139819281
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d96c69ab4aeefa7688c6571afcffc42c009684a OP_EQUALVERIFY OP_CHECKSIG
address
LY8cAM6HHTfPpURZzUifmwWdvgMHVSdcyZ
transaction
e0f2b58a1d7c2f4bcc14b8145848356b052003396b70ca256935bbe30358c876
spent
true